What Should You Do if Your Phone Gets Wet?
If your phone gets wet, the first thing you should do is turn it off. If you can, remove the battery and SIM card. Then, use a clean, dry cloth to wipe down the phone. If possible, prop the phone up so that air can circulate around it and help it dry out.

If your iPhone has been in contact with water, it’s important to act fast. The longer it sits in water, the greater the chance of permanent damage.
Here are a few tips for iPhone water damage repair in Auckland:
- Turn off your phone as soon as possible. This will help prevent any further damage from occurring.
- Remove the SIM card and any other removable components. These can be dried separately.
- Use a vacuum cleaner with the hose attachment to suck out any water from the phone’s ports and openings. Be careful not to press too hard, as this could cause more damage.
- Place the phone in a container of rice or silica gel packets to absorb moisture. Leave it for 24-48 hours before trying to turn it on again.
- If your phone doesn’t power on after 48 hours, it’s time to seek professional help. A qualified technician will be able to diagnose the problem and determine if repairs are possible.
